About this opportunity

The Norma Evans Education Award is a regional bursary offered by Rural Women New Zealand (RWNZ) Region Five (Rimanui) to encourage women seeking advancement in the workforce to obtain qualifications to improve their career opportunities, independence and career development. The award was created by fellow RWNZ members to honor an outstanding woman who has spent her life working to create healthy, sustainable rural communities. The award provides up to $2000 for one year of tertiary study to a woman who wishes to complete a tertiary study programme to assist her to return to or enter the workforce, thereby enabling her to better develop her career. Consideration may be given for a second year's grant of up to $2000 depending on the tertiary study undertaken and the grades achieved. Applicants must be New Zealand citizens aged 25 years or older, and must live and/or intend to work in the Coromandel, Thames, or Bay of Plenty regions. The award supports short or long term courses with a recognised education provider.
